**Q3 Planning Note — Annual Billing Shift**

Department heads: Marlowe Analytics moves all new Fenwick Suite contracts to annual billing from October. Monthly plans close to new signups; existing customers migrate at renewal. Expect short-term cash flow lift and some churn in the small-tier segment. Support scripts update next sprint. Context on why we're accelerating this follows below.

internal memo for bahap-yagug: Headcount on the Ulaix team goes from 3 to 100 by the end of January. Gross margin on Ulaix came in at 10 percent against a plan of 15 percent.

// MAX_LEDGER_BATCH: cap on loyalty-points ledger entries written per
// transaction in the Pinecrest rewards service. Raising this risks lock
// contention on the ledger table during peak redemption windows; lowering
// it slows the nightly reconciliation job. Changed once before (incident
// review, spring cycle) and reverted within a day. Do not touch without
// running the redemption load test first. If paged on ledger lag, check
// this value against the deployed build recorded below.

trace token, fafog-kageg: htk4_98e6

### 2.8.1 — Key Rotation

Heads up, new folks: we rotated the signing key for PickPath, our warehouse pick-list optimizer. The old key expired after the Brindlewood audit flagged its age, so builds signed before this release won't verify anymore — re-pull from the release bucket instead of trusting cached artifacts. Nothing else changed functionally; routing logic is untouched. Update your local verification config with the new key, which follows here.

rollout seal: bky4_x7Gc